What Are Timelapse Cameras for Construction?
The timelapse technique involves capturing still images at regular intervals and later compiling them into videos that condense long periods into just a few minutes. In construction, this process allows tracking the evolution of a project from start to finish.
These cameras are strategically positioned to provide a comprehensive view of the job site, recording key stages such as:
- Earthworks
- Foundation construction
- Structural building
- Final finishes
The goal goes beyond mere visual aesthetics; timelapse provides a continuous and detailed recording of onsite events, allowing otherwise invisible changes to be clearly and objectively identified.
Benefits of Timelapse Cameras in Construction Technology
Timelapse cameras in construction are not just innovative documentation tools. Their practical applications bring distinct benefits in areas like management, safety, and communication. Below are the major impacts:
1. Comprehensive Monitoring and Documentation
Timelapse enables real-time, remote monitoring of all stages of the project, allowing engineers and managers to identify bottlenecks, make strategic adjustments, and ensure deadlines are met. Additionally, accelerated videos provide a broad perspective to detect inefficiencies and create proactive solutions.
This documentation also has legal value. In cases of contractual disputes, timelapse serves as objective evidence that can clarify delays, errors, or deviations from quality standards.
2. Streamlined Communication Across Stakeholders
Timelapse videos also work as visual reporting tools at the end of each cycle (weekly or monthly), ensuring all parties are aligned.
3. Marketing and Promotional Tool
Impressing prospective clients and investors is essential in the construction industry to secure new projects. Timelapse cameras transform projects into visually impactful success stories — perfect for social media and corporate presentations. Displaying the progression of completed builds generates trust and solidifies a brand’s reputation in the market.
4. Improved Safety on Job Sites
Another practical benefit highlighted by Construction Technology is the enhancement of safety. Reviewing recorded footage allows managers to identify imminent risks, inappropriate behavior, or failures in operational protocols. This enables preventative measures to be implemented before issues arise.
Technical Considerations and Equipment Choices
Choosing the ideal camera is critical for capturing high-quality content. Here are the essential factors when configuring a timelapse system:
- Resolution: 4K cameras provide precise detail.
- Durability: Construction demands rugged devices resistant to the elements.
- Battery and Connectivity: Long-term autonomy is highly desirable for large-scale projects, along with solar-powered systems and 4G connectivity for remote access.
- Cloud Platforms: Integration with real-time management platforms saves time and maximizes operational efficiency.
By adopting robust solutions, companies not only reduce operational costs but also gain reliability in records across the entire project.
International Study: Validating Efficiency
A study titled “Computer Vision for Construction Progress Monitoring: A Real-Time Object Detection Approach“ explores the use of computer vision algorithms to enhance project monitoring. This method combines real-time image analysis with camera footage, offering powerful management solutions.
The research highlights how the combination of smart cameras and algorithms delivers benefits such as cost reduction and better-informed decisions throughout construction. These advancements partially automate progress tracking, enabling greater efficiency and less need for frequent in-person site visits.
The Future of Timelapse in Construction
As technology continues to evolve, the use of timelapse cameras is being integrated with other innovations such as drones, Building Information Modeling (BIM), and artificial intelligence (AI). Automated observation using AI-based algorithms already enables:
- Detection of delays or structural issues
- Identification of patterns to improve processes
- Optimization of edits and visual reports
As part of the Construction 4.0 revolution, timelapse is expected to evolve into fully technology-driven project management, optimizing costs, communication, and safety.
